NOTE THAT THIS ROLE INVARIABLY INVOLVES BEING AWAY FROM HOME 4 NIGHTS PER WEEK, EVERY WEEK at various client sites throughout the UK.

As a Ground Worker, you will play a vital role in preparing and executing groundworks for the installation of garage equipment, including vehicle lifts and MOT bays. You will ensure that all groundwork is completed to the highest standard, adhering to health and safety regulations.
